Effect of supplementation with a cysteine donor on muscular performance.

Resumé
Oxidative stress contributes to muscular fatigue. GSH is the major
intracellular antioxidant, the biosynthesis of which is dependent on
cysteine availability. We hypothesized that supplementation with a
whey-based cysteine donor [Immunocal (HMS90)] designed to augment
intracellular GSH would enhance performance. Twenty healthy young
adults (10 men, 10 women) were studied presupplementation and 3 mo
postsupplementation with either Immunocal (20 g/day) or casein placebo.
Muscular performance was assessed by whole leg isokinetic cycle
testing, measuring peak power and 30-s work capacity. Lymphocyte
GSH was used as a marker of tissue GSH. There were no baseline
differences (age, ht, wt, %ideal wt, peak power, 30-s work capacity).
Follow-up data on 18 subjects (9 Immunocal, 9 placebo) were analyzed.
Both peak power [13 +/- 3.5 (SE) %, P < 0.02] and 30-s work
capacity (13 +/- 3.7%, P < 0.03) increased significantly in the
Immunocal group, with no change (2 +/- 9.0 and 1 +/- 9.3%) in the
placebo group. Lymphocyte GSH also increased significantly in the
Immunocal group (35.5 +/- 11.04%, P < 0.02), with no change in the
placebo group (-0.9 +/- 9.6%). This is the first study to demonstrate that prolonged supplementation with a product designed to augment
antioxidant defenses resulted in improved volitional performance.
